If you’re in the mood for comfort food that’s luxuriously creamy, unquestionably hearty, and deliciously Italian all at once, you absolutely have to try Creamy Italian Spaghetti with Ground Beef. This recipe brings together tender spaghetti, rich marinara, savory ground beef, and a swirl of cream for a pasta dish that feels both elegant and homey. One bite, and you’ll see why this is a weeknight favorite in countless kitchens—it’s truly everything you want in an Italian dinner, all in one bowl!

Ingredients You’ll Need
The beauty of Creamy Italian Spaghetti with Ground Beef is in its use of simple, familiar ingredients that each play a vital role in every forkful. You’ll find that every item adds something unique—whether it’s a fresh burst, a mellow richness, or a pop of color.
- Spaghetti (12 ounces): Classic pasta shape that’s perfect for catching creamy sauce in every strand.
- Olive Oil (1 tablespoon): Helps sauté the beef and onions, infusing richness and a touch of Mediterranean aroma.
- Ground Beef (1 pound): Adds hearty flavor and turns this pasta into a satisfying main course.
- Yellow Onion, finely chopped (1 small): Lends sweetness and depth to the sauce as it cooks down with the beef.
- Garlic, minced (3 cloves): Essential for irresistible aroma and a true Italian backbone.
- Italian Seasoning (1 teaspoon): Balances herbs like basil and oregano for that distinctly Italian flavor.
- Crushed Red Pepper Flakes (1/2 teaspoon, optional): For those who enjoy a gentle kick of heat—add more or less to taste.
- Salt (1/2 teaspoon): Brings out all the natural flavors in the sauce, pasta, and beef.
- Black Pepper (1/4 teaspoon): Adds a subtle warmth to complement the creamy sauce.
- Marinara Sauce (1 jar, 24 ounces): Brings acidity, sweetness, and tomato-rich depth to the dish.
- Heavy Cream (1/2 cup): Transforms the sauce into something impossibly silky and lush.
- Grated Parmesan Cheese (1/2 cup): Melts into the sauce for a savory, nutty finish.
- Fresh Parsley, chopped (1/4 cup + more for garnish): Adds color and a burst of green freshness to brighten the final dish.
How to Make Creamy Italian Spaghetti with Ground Beef
Step 1: Cook the Spaghetti
Bring a large pot of salted water to a boil, then drop in your spaghetti and cook according to the package until perfectly al dente. Remember to taste a strand—there should be just a slight chew in the center. Drain thoroughly and set aside.
Step 2: Brown the Beef
While the pasta bubbles away, heat up the olive oil in a large skillet over medium heat. Add the ground beef, breaking it up with a spoon as it cooks. You want the meat to brown and caramelize a bit—this is key for building that crave-worthy flavor base in Creamy Italian Spaghetti with Ground Beef!
Step 3: Sauté Aromatics
Once your beef is nicely browned, stir in the finely chopped onion and minced garlic. Let everything cook together for 2 to 3 minutes until your kitchen smells absolutely mouthwatering and the onions are soft and translucent.
Step 4: Season Everything
Sprinkle the Italian seasoning, crushed red pepper flakes (if you like a little kick), salt, and black pepper right into the skillet. Stir well to let those spices mingle with the beef and onions—these seasonings make every bite taste like pure, classic Italy.
Step 5: Add Marinara and Simmer
Pour in the marinara sauce and stir until everything is beautifully coated. Reduce the heat to low and let the sauce gently simmer for about 5 minutes; this is when all those flavors really come together.
Step 6: Make it Creamy
Now comes the moment that sets Creamy Italian Spaghetti with Ground Beef apart—stir in the heavy cream and Parmesan cheese! Watch as the sauce transforms into a velvety, creamy hug for your pasta. Stir until the mixture is well blended and luscious.
Step 7: Combine and Finish
Add your cooked spaghetti right into the skillet. Toss everything together until those glossy noodles are enveloped in that dreamy, creamy sauce. Sprinkle in chopped parsley for a fresh, verdant finish—then you’re ready to serve!
How to Serve Creamy Italian Spaghetti with Ground Beef

Garnishes
For an extra touch of elegance, sprinkle each bowl with a little more fresh parsley and a generous shower of grated Parmesan. A twist of black pepper over the top can add a subtle punch, and if you love a touch of heat, a few red pepper flakes work beautifully.
Side Dishes
This rich and hearty pasta loves good company! A simple green salad with a tangy vinaigrette lifts the flavors, while warm garlic bread is perfect for swiping up every last bit of sauce. Roasted vegetables or a classic Caprese salad are always welcome alongside Creamy Italian Spaghetti with Ground Beef, balancing out all that creamy richness.
Creative Ways to Present
You can plate your Creamy Italian Spaghetti with Ground Beef in individual bowls with swirling tongs for a restaurant-worthy presentation. Or, nestle it onto a big family-style platter with basil leaves and extra Parmesan for a festive feel. For something fun, twist small servings onto appetizer spoons or in little ramekins for a party or potluck.
Make Ahead and Storage
Storing Leftovers
Leftover Creamy Italian Spaghetti with Ground Beef keeps wonderfully in an airtight container in the refrigerator for up to four days. The flavors meld even further, making for fabulous next-day lunches or easy weeknight dinners.
Freezing
Want to save it for another time? Let the pasta cool completely, then portion it into freezer-safe containers. It will keep well for up to two months. Consider freezing individual portions for quick meals later—just thaw overnight in the fridge before reheating.
Reheating
The best way to reheat is gently on the stovetop over low heat, adding a splash of milk or cream to revive that lovely sauce. If you’re short on time, microwave in 30-second bursts, stirring in between, until heated through and just as creamy as when you first made it.
FAQs
Can I use a different type Main Course
Absolutely! While spaghetti is classic for Creamy Italian Spaghetti with Ground Beef, feel free to swap in linguine, penne, or even rigatoni. Each shape brings its own character, but all will absorb that luscious sauce perfectly.
How do I make it spicier?
If you love heat, don’t hesitate to increase the crushed red pepper flakes or even stir in a dash of hot sauce. Taste as you go so you find the perfect amount of kick for your crowd.
Can I substitute the beef with another protein?
Yes, ground turkey, chicken, or Italian sausage all work beautifully in this recipe. Each substitution will bring its own unique flavor twist to Creamy Italian Spaghetti with Ground Beef—so don’t be afraid to experiment!
Is there a lighter alternative to heavy cream?
For a lighter version, you can use half-and-half or whole milk, though the sauce may be slightly less rich. Stirring in a spoonful of Greek yogurt after removing from heat can also boost creaminess without extra fat.
Can this dish be made in advance?
Certainly! Prepare the sauce ahead of time (through the simmer step), then simply cook the spaghetti and combine everything right before serving. This makes Creamy Italian Spaghetti with Ground Beef a wonderful option for easy entertaining or meal prep.
Final Thoughts
There’s something irresistibly inviting about a big bowl of Creamy Italian Spaghetti with Ground Beef, whether it’s for a cozy night at home or sharing with people you love. With a handful of simple ingredients and a little bit of magic, you can create a pasta dish that’s creamy, savory, and absolutely satisfying. Give it a try—you just might find your next go-to dinner!
Print
Creamy Italian Spaghetti with Ground Beef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ings
- Category: Main Course
- Method: Stovetop
- Cuisine: Italian-American
- Diet: Non-Vegetarian
Description
Indulge in a comforting bowl of Creamy Italian Spaghetti with Ground Beef. This easy-to-make pasta dish is rich, flavorful, and perfect for a satisfying weeknight dinner.
Ingredients
Spaghetti:
12 ounces spaghetti;
Ground Beef Mixture:
1 tablespoon olive oil; 1 pound ground beef; 1 small yellow onion, finely chopped; 3 cloves garlic, minced; 1 teaspoon Italian seasoning; 1/2 teaspoon crushed red pepper flakes (optional); 1/2 teaspoon salt; 1/4 teaspoon black pepper; 1 (24-ounce) jar marinara sauce;
Creamy Sauce:
1/2 cup heavy cream; 1/2 cup grated Parmesan cheese; 1/4 cup chopped fresh parsley (plus more for garnish)
Instructions
- Cook Spaghetti: Boil spaghetti until al dente, then drain and set aside.
- Prepare Ground Beef Mixture: Brown ground beef in olive oil. Add onion, garlic, seasoning, pepper, and salt. Stir in marinara sauce and simmer.
- Make Creamy Sauce: Add heavy cream and Parmesan cheese to the beef mixture. Toss in cooked spaghetti and parsley.
- Serve: Garnish with parsley and extra Parmesan. Enjoy!
Notes
- You can substitute ground turkey or Italian sausage for the beef.
- For a thicker sauce, let it simmer a few extra minutes before adding the cream.
- Leftovers can be refrigerated for up to 4 days and reheated on the stovetop.
Nutrition
- Serving Size: 1 bowl
- Calories: 610
- Sugar: 7g
- Sodium: 740mg
- Fat: 28g
- Saturated Fat: 13g
- Unsaturated Fat: 12g
- Trans Fat: 0g
- Carbohydrates: 60g
- Fiber: 4g
- Protein: 29g
- Cholesterol: 95mg